ABSTRACT:
An auxiliary power unit intake duct for an aircraft, comprisingan internal straight portion1a, an internal first bend portion1band an internal second bend portion1c, extending between an air inlet2and a plenum entry3of the auxiliary power unit,a plurality of acoustic guides vanes4,5located in the straight portion1aof the intake duct1, extending horizontally between opposite side portions of the straight portion1a;and a plurality of curved aerodynamic guide vanes6,7located in the second bend portion1cproximate to said plenum inlet3, extending vertically between a top portion and a bottom portion of the second bend portion1c, each of the curved aerodynamic guide vanes6,7being concentric with said bend curvature of the second bend portion1c.
